Overall Purpose of Role:

You will join the product team at the core of delivering high quality, innovative and relevant solutions to the LME with the purpose of:

  • In conjunction with the business owner, sets the product vision, objectives and outcomes

  • Accountable for maximizing the value of the product, the delivery of the product goal and product backlog

  • Represent the needs of the many stakeholders across LME and LME Clear

  • Has the mandate to make business decisions where impact is contained within the product

  • Owns the product backlog prioritisation and sequencing, ensuring the team implements the right requirements

  • Accountable for all stages of the delivery

Responsibilities:

  • Work closely with Business Owner and Service Owner and other stakeholders to define the roadmap with the key product goals and objectives needed to deliver the solution. Build and maintain a healthy backlog

  • Constantly manage priorities to ensure work is focused, with effective management and refinement of the product backlog

  • Provide vision and direction to the delivery teams; ensure that the team always has a healthy backlog of work

  • Provide an active role in mitigating impediments impacting successful team completion of Release/Sprint Goals

  • Ensure scope is always clear and understood and support teams to elaborate and break-down features

  • Lead the scoping of product releases; set the expectation for delivery of new functionalities

  • Evaluate the work generated by the delivery teams against Acceptance Criteria and desired outcomes

  • Collaborate and coordinate with other Product Owners as applicable

  • Manage stakeholders

  • Create user stories, epics, and features and acceptance criteria

  • Gathering requirements and writing high level requirements

  • Key participant in Sprint Planning and agreeing content for each Sprint

Desirable Academic and Professional Qualifications Required:

  • Agile Leadership Training

  • CSPO (Certified Scrum Product Owner) – Product Owner Certification

  • PSPO (Professional Scrum Product Owner) preferable not essential

Required Knowledge and Level of Experience:

  • Experience working as a Product Owner / Product Manager

  • Experience working in an exchange or financial organization desirable

  • Sound knowledge in IT, management, and agile software development.

  • Experience of using agile methods and frameworks e.g. Scrum, Kanban and Lean as a minimum

What We Do

HKEX Group is a global exchange group, operating dynamic and integrated financial markets in Asia and Europe. From our home in the financial hub of Hong Kong and an additional base in London, we provide world-class facilities for trading and clearing securities and derivatives in Equities, Commodities, Fixed Income and Currency. Uniquely positioned at the intersection of Chinese and international capital flows, Hong Kong has long been Connecting China with the World. With the accelerated opening-up of China’s capital markets, HKEX continues to be at the forefront of this historic transition, which we believe will Shape the Global Market Landscape
